Root Canal Treatment (RCT)

What is Root Canal Treatment (RCT)?
Root Canal Treatment, commonly known as RCT, is a dental procedure that treats infection or inflammation inside the tooth’s pulp (the soft tissue containing nerves and blood vessels). This treatment saves the natural tooth by removing infected tissue, cleaning the root canals, and sealing them to prevent further infection.

Who Needs Root Canal Treatment?

  • Patients experiencing severe tooth pain or sensitivity due to deep decay or injury
  • Teeth with infected or abscessed pulp causing swelling or discomfort
  • Individuals with cracked or fractured teeth exposing the pulp to bacteria
  • Those seeking to save a damaged tooth rather than opting for extraction

Benefits of Root Canal Treatment:

  • Pain Relief: Eliminates toothache caused by infection or inflammation.
  • Preserves Natural Teeth: Saves your tooth from extraction, maintaining natural bite and smile.
  • Prevents Spread of Infection: Stops infection from spreading to surrounding tissues and bone.
  • Restores Function: Allows you to chew and bite normally with a treated tooth.
  • Improves Oral Health: Maintains overall dental structure and prevents complications.

The Procedure at Shivaya Dental Clinic:

  • Detailed examination and digital imaging by Dr. Chandan Sinha to assess tooth condition
  • Removal of infected pulp tissue under local anesthesia to ensure patient comfort
  • Cleaning, shaping, and disinfecting of root canals to eliminate bacteria
  • Filling and sealing the canals with biocompatible material to prevent reinfection
  • Final restoration with a crown or filling to protect the tooth and restore strength

Aftercare & Maintenance:

  • Maintain good oral hygiene with brushing and flossing
  • Avoid chewing hard foods on the treated tooth until fully restored
  • Attend follow-up appointments for evaluation and crown placement
  • Regular dental check-ups to ensure long-term success
